As a Renewal Manager at Gong, you’ll play a key role in managing the renewal process of our fast-growing Corporate customer base while working closely with Digital Support and Customer Success as needed to ensure a #ravingfans customer experience. Renewal Managers are responsible for managing the contract renewal process for Gong’s platform and services. This role focuses on ensuring customer retention, maximizing renewal rates, and identifying opportunities for upselling or cross-selling. You will also be instrumental in helping to build our process around renewals management and advocate for process updates to improve operational efficiency.

RESPONSIBILITIES

  • Manage the end-to-end renewal process for all assigned contract renewals, ensuring timely and successful contract renewals.
  • Identify opportunities for upselling and cross-selling additional products or services to existing customers.
  • Develop and present compelling value propositions that meet customer needs.
  • Drive live engagements directly with customers to ensure partnership alignment and negotiate agreements for the next contract term
  • Develop and execute strategies to maximize renewal rates and minimize churn.
  • Enlist the efforts of Digital Customer Success and senior leadership when necessary to accelerate the contract renewal process, mitigate identified risk, and ensure customer satisfaction
  • Own contract processes to close - including reviewing renewal details, quote creation, maintenance of Gong dealboard and Salesforce opportunity records, sending of order forms, forecasting renewals outcomes, and tracking progress of signature to close.
  • Identify at-risk accounts and put together a strategy to secure the renewal, as needed
  • Partner with CS Ops and Sales Ops to communicate challenges in our current renewal process and advocate for improvements to increase our operational efficiency
  • Identify opportunities to expand Gong’s footprint and differentiated value within an account as part of the renewal process
  • Establish and maintain effective, cooperative working relationships with customers, both via phone and email. This includes objection-handling and problem-solving when customers request discounts, indicate they don’t want to renew, alert us that they’re evaluating competing solutions, etc.

What you need to know about the San Francisco Tech Scene

San Francisco and the surrounding Bay Area attracts more startup funding than any other region in the world. Home to Stanford University and UC Berkeley, leading VC firms and several of the world’s most valuable companies, the Bay Area is the place to go for anyone looking to make it big in the tech industry. That said, San Francisco has a lot to offer beyond technology thanks to a thriving art and music scene, excellent food and a short drive to several of the country’s most beautiful recreational areas.

Key Facts About San Francisco Tech

  • Number of Tech Workers: 365,500; 13.9% of overall workforce (2024 CompTIA survey)
  • Major Tech Employers: Google, Apple, Salesforce, Meta
  • Key Industries: Artificial intelligence, cloud computing, fintech, consumer technology, software
  • Funding Landscape: $50.5 billion in venture capital funding in 2024 (Pitchbook)
  • Notable Investors: Sequoia Capital, Andreessen Horowitz, Bessemer Venture Partners, Greylock Partners, Khosla Ventures, Kleiner Perkins
  • Research Centers and Universities: Stanford University; University of California, Berkeley; University of San Francisco; Santa Clara University; Ames Research Center; Center for AI Safety; California Institute for Regenerative Medicine
